The authors' pseudonym "Three Initiates" is speculated to represent William Walker Atkinson, Michael Whitty, and Paul Foster Case (co-founder of The Builders of the Adytum), although later publishers of the work attribute Atkinson as the sole author. The content comprises seven so-called tenets of Hermetic thought, which have been re-published and expanded upon from numerous sources in the decades since The Kybalion first appeared in 1908. Unfortunately, it discloses little of authentic Hermetic philosophy as discussed in the original Hermetika BCE 6th–CE 1st, but serves the inventions of a few adepts of the western esoteric tradition.

About this Edition of the Kybalion:

The text as it has been known and loved since its first publication years ago is rendered faithfully for a new generation of readers to enjoy.

This little book of wisdom covers a wide variety of topics within a fairly short space and elaborates on the popularly discussed hermetic principals. While the material is a strange mix of hermetic and new thought philosophy it has shaped the modern spiritual community in a way that makes it nearly essential reading.

Those who have missed out on previous editions of this book or are simply looking for a good kindle compatible version will be well served to pick up this edition.
